Dealing with Grief During the Holidays

It’s been 710 days since my mom died. This is our second round of holidays without her–our second round of everything without her. It’s a widely-accepted belief that the first year after you lose someone is the hardest. But lately, several people I know who have also lost a loved one, have told me that the second year was actually harder for them. And I agree, because that has been my experience, too.
